Difference between revisions of "Samba4 port: libkdc Interface"
From K5Wiki
Line 77: | Line 77: | ||
{| class="wikitable sortable" width="100%" border="1" style="border-collapse: collapse; border: 1px solid #dfdfdf;" |
{| class="wikitable sortable" width="100%" border="1" style="border-collapse: collapse; border: 1px solid #dfdfdf;" |
||
+ | | bgcolor="#666600" |<font color="#ffffff">'''Protocol'''</font> |
||
| bgcolor="#666600" |<font color="#ffffff">'''Heimdal fcn''' </font> |
| bgcolor="#666600" |<font color="#ffffff">'''Heimdal fcn''' </font> |
||
| bgcolor="#666600" |<font color="#ffffff">'''MIT-krb fcn'''</font> |
| bgcolor="#666600" |<font color="#ffffff">'''MIT-krb fcn'''</font> |
||
Line 82: | Line 83: | ||
|- |
|- |
||
+ | | AS |
||
| decode_AS_REQ() |
| decode_AS_REQ() |
||
| decode_krb5_as_req() |
| decode_krb5_as_req() |
||
Line 87: | Line 89: | ||
|- |
|- |
||
+ | | AS |
||
| free_AS_REQ() |
| free_AS_REQ() |
||
| krb5_free_kdc_req() |
| krb5_free_kdc_req() |
||
Line 92: | Line 95: | ||
|- |
|- |
||
+ | | AS |
||
| _kdc_as_rep() |
| _kdc_as_rep() |
||
| process_as_req() |
| process_as_req() |
||
Line 97: | Line 101: | ||
|- |
|- |
||
+ | | TGS |
||
| decode_TGS_REQ |
| decode_TGS_REQ |
||
| decode_krb5_tgs_req() |
| decode_krb5_tgs_req() |
||
Line 102: | Line 107: | ||
|- |
|- |
||
+ | | TGS |
||
| free_TGS_REQ() |
| free_TGS_REQ() |
||
| krb5_free_kdc_req() |
| krb5_free_kdc_req() |
||
Line 107: | Line 113: | ||
|- |
|- |
||
+ | | TGS |
||
| _kdc_tgs_rep() |
| _kdc_tgs_rep() |
||
| process_tgs_req() |
| process_tgs_req() |
Revision as of 18:19, 9 September 2009
libkdc Entry Points:
Entry Point | Heimdal file | Samba4 file | Samba4 callers |
kdc_log() | kdc/log.c | heimdal/kdc/log.c | no |
kdc_log_msg() | kdc/log.c | heimdal/kdc/log.c | no |
kdc_log_msg_va() | kdc/log.c | heimdal/kdc/log.c | no |
kdc_openlog() | kdc/log.c | heimdal/kdc/log.c | no |
krb5_kdc_get_config() | kdc/default_config.c | kdc/kdc.c | kdc/kdc.c |
krb5_kdc_process_krb5_request() | kdc/process.c | heimdal/kdc/process.c | kdc/kdc.c |
krb5_kdc_process_request() | kdc/process.c | heimdal/kdc/process.c | no |
krb5_kdc_set_dbinfo() | kdc/set_dbinfo.c | no | no |
krb5_kdc_save_request() | kdc/process.c | heimdal/kdc/process.c | no |
krb5_kdc_update_time() | kdc/process.c | heimdal/kdc/process.c | kdc/kdc.c |
krb5_kdc_windc_init() | kdc/windc.c | heimdal/kdc/windc.c | kdc/kdc.c |
Protocol | Heimdal fcn | MIT-krb fcn | Samba4 callers |
AS | decode_AS_REQ() | decode_krb5_as_req() | krb5_kdc_process_request() |
AS | free_AS_REQ() | krb5_free_kdc_req() | krb5_kdc_process_request() |
AS | _kdc_as_rep() | process_as_req() | krb5_kdc_process_request() |
TGS | decode_TGS_REQ | decode_krb5_tgs_req() | krb5_kdc_process_request() |
TGS | free_TGS_REQ() | krb5_free_kdc_req() | krb5_kdc_process_request() |
TGS | _kdc_tgs_rep() | process_tgs_req() | krb5_kdc_process_request() |